{"data":{"id":"us-ca/gov-18540.2","jurisdiction":"us-ca","citation":"GOV § 18540.2","heading":"","body":"“State military emergency,” as used in this part, means an emergency declared and terminable by the Governor by proclamation during, but not limited to, such times as the United States is conscripting personnel for service in the armed forces.","path":["Government Code - GOV","TITLE 2.
